LUCKNOW, Dec. 21 -- Chief minister Yogi Adityanath on Saturday announced that Uttar Pradesh will observe a Statewide Road Safety Month from January 1 to 31, 2026, according to an official statement.

The decision was prompted by alarm over 24,776 deaths in 46,223 road accidents across UP till November 2025.

He directed that the campaign be implemented strictly on the 4E model - education, enforcement, engineering and emergency care - with equal focus on all four pillars.

He called the rising number of road accidents a serious social challenge that requires firm action, mass participation and sustained behavioural change.
